About The Role

Administrator - Permanent Opportunity
DIVISION: Central LOCATION: Hillsborough, Northern Ireland

We are delighted to be recruiting for an experienced Administrator, to join us in our Hillsborough Head Office. This role will sit within the Integrated Management Systems (IMS) Team, which is responsible for facilitating the company processes and procedures.

Reporting to the Head of Integrated Management Systems, the Administrator will be responsible for the IMS process and documentation infrastructure across all divisions and regions.

Our ideal candidate will be process driven and will have the ability to balance priorities and deadlines. We are particularly interested in speaking with candidates who possess strong SharePoint skills and who are familiar with VISO.

Expected duties include:

1. Responsible for the IMS process and documentation infrastructure across the divisions and regions.
2. Ensuring GRAHAM processes and process maps are fully interconnected with appropriate inputs/outputs and conducting gap analysis to identify processes and process flows which need further development.
3. Facilitating the development of the IMS SharePoint platform to continuously improve system functionality for end users and central governance
4. Managing IMS Change Control process and oversee all updates to new and existing IMS processes and supporting documents.

Essential Requirements:

5. Relevant experience in a similar fast paced role.
6. Familiarity with the fundamentals of process mapping
7. Experience of managing and controlling processes/documents in SharePoint
8. Implement good working knowledge of MS Visio or similar process mapping / modelling software
Desirable Requirements:
9. Previous experience in a Construction organisation
